Jue Zhan Tian Huang

Overview

Jue Zhan Tian Huang (決戰天皇, literally as "The war against the Emperor") is a beat 'em up game made by a unknown company (presumably from China) made for Arcade machines in 2000. The game is known to feature four characters from The King of Fighters series as playable characters: Kyo, Iori, Chizuru, Chin, and featuring Street Fighter II: The World Warrior characters as enemies.
